ZIP code 32219 is located in Jacksonville, Florida, within Duval County. It covers approximately 71.48 square miles and serves a population of 14,145 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one, served by area code 904.

About ZIP code 32219

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the 2000s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$193,700. Owner-occupancy is high at 86%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$60,100. 33%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 26 minutes is near the national average.

College attainment at 17% is below the national average, consistent with a trades and production-oriented local economy.

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(23%) compared to national benchmarks.

Notable community characteristics include a notable veteran presence at 18% of civilians, above the national average of 7%.

Overall, ZIP code 32219 reflects a community defined by a trades-oriented workforce, a strong veteran community, high homeownership, and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
